Legislative Proposal, Bill or Resolution
- Bill C-45 (Cannabis Act) with respect to rules and regulations related to the cultivation of marijuana in a residence.
- Consultations regarding proposed changes to tax rules for private corporations
- Federal Budget with respect to tax measures to permit the rollover of Recaptured Capital Costs, working to enhance the value through indexation of the Registered Retirement Savings Plan Home Buyers' Plan for Canadian homebuyers, as well as enabling home buyers to re-use the Home Buyers' Plan after significant life events.
- Income tax act with regard to indexing the Home Buyers' Plan to the Consumer Price Index, as well as enabling home buyers to re-use the Home Buyers' Plan after significant life events.
- Income tax act with regard to the deferral of capital cost allowance recapture for real property investments.
Legislative Proposal, Bill or Resolution, Policies or Program
- Immigrant Investor Program with respect to the review of the program and the Immigration and Refugee Protection Act with respect to immigrant investment in Canada
Legislative Proposal, Bill or Resolution, Policies or Program, Regulation
- An Act respecting certain measures in response to COVID-19 and other COVID-19 related policy with respect to support for the self-employed, independent contractors, small businesses, those living on a commission-based income.
Legislative Proposal, Bill or Resolution, Regulation
- Income Tax Act and regulations with respect to the more than five employee test to qualify as an active business for real estate
- Lobbying Act and related regulations with respect members of boards of directors of non-profit organizations
- Species at Risk Act with respect to compensation provisions
Policies or Program
- Anti-Money Laundering and Terrorist Financing Policy with respect to the National Risk Assessment with respect to its impact on REALTORS(R).
- Canada Mortgage and Housing Corporation policy with respect to serving underserved markets with mortgage default insurance, policy with respect to mortgage default insurance deductibles and role as a public sector provider of mortgage default insurance.
- Canada Mortgage and Housing Corporation with respect to the composition of its Board of Directors
- Canadian government's role with respect to the Financial Action Task Force (FATF) as it impacts the Proceeds of Crime (Money Laundering) and Terrorist Financing Act and regulations.
- Comprehensive Financial Consumer Code with respect to mortgage policy
- First-Time Home Buyers' Tax Credit with respect to impact on first-time homebuyers.
- Implementation of Code of Conduct for Federally Regulated Financial Institutions—Mortgage Prepayment Information with respect to enhancing borrower awareness
- Marihuana Grow Operations (MGO) and clandestine labs with respect to registries of former MGOs and clandesine labs and remediation standards.
- Memorandum of Understanding between the Canadian Real Estate Association and PWGSC, re: the disposal of federal surplus property
- Mortage financing rules under the juridiction of the Office of the Superintendent of Financial Institutions
- Registered Retirement Savings Plan Home Buyers' Plan - Working to enhance the value of the program through indexation for Canadian home buyers.
- Risk Based Approach guidance provided by the Financial Transactions and Reports Analysis Sector with respect to its impact on REALTORS(R).
Policies or Program, Regulation
- Budget 2014 commitment to reduce the burden of complying with the Proceeds of Crime (Money Laundering)
and Terrorist Financing Act (PCMLTFA) requirements that necessitate searches of 19 separate sanctions and known terrorist lists.
- Implementation of Canada's Anti-Spam Legislation and accompanying regulations and interpretive guidance with respect to electronic messages sent by REALTORS(R).
- Proceeds of Crime (Money Laundering) and Terrorist Financing Act with respect to the implementation of the Regulations Amending the Proceeds of Crime (Money Laundering) and Terrorist Financing Regulations published in the Canada Gazette Part II on February 13, 2013 and the guidance provided by FINTRAC as a result of those regulations and their impact on real estate agents and brokers.
Regulation
- Marihuana for Medical Purposes Regulations (MMPR) with respect to licensing, disclosure and remediation of production sites, and disclosure and remediation of properties licensed under the Marihauna Medical Access Regulations (MMAR).
- National Do Not Call List - implementation. Working to ensure compliance with all regulations.
- Proceeds of Crime (Money Laundering) and Terrorist Financing Act - regulations regarding reporting requirements
- The Canadian Aviation Regulations with respect to the use of Unmanned Aerial Vehicles for use for real estate listings.
- The Proceeds of Crime (Money Laundering) and Terrorist Financing (PCMLTF) with respect to compliance regarding mere postings on Multiple Listing Service (R) Systems, and application to For Sale By Owner Companies and auctioneers.
- The Proceeds of Crime (Money Laundering) and Terrorist Financing (PCMLTFA) with respect to a threshold for and reduced compliance for small business.
- The mortgage insurance guarantee framework with respect to changes to mortgage financing rules for homebuyers
